~ubuntu-branches/ubuntu/saucy/moodle/saucy

« back to all changes in this revision

Viewing changes to badges/mybackpack.php

  • Committer: Package Import Robot
  • Author(s): Thijs Kinkhorst
  • Date: 2013-09-09 15:22:35 UTC
  • mfrom: (1.1.17) (3.1.29 sid)
  • Revision ID: package-import@ubuntu.com-20130909152235-f5g7gphaseb84qeu
Tags: 2.5.2-1
* New upstream version: 2.5.2.
  - Incorporates S3 security patch.

Show diffs side-by-side

added added

removed removed

Lines of Context:
53
53
$PAGE->set_pagelayout('mydashboard');
54
54
 
55
55
$backpack = $DB->get_record('badge_backpack', array('userid' => $USER->id));
 
56
$badgescache = cache::make('core', 'externalbadges');
56
57
 
57
58
if ($disconnect && $backpack) {
58
59
    require_sesskey();
59
60
    $DB->delete_records('badge_external', array('backpackid' => $backpack->id));
60
61
    $DB->delete_records('badge_backpack', array('userid' => $USER->id));
 
62
    $badgescache->delete($USER->id);
61
63
    redirect(new moodle_url('/badges/mybackpack.php'));
62
64
}
63
65
 
103
105
                $DB->insert_record('badge_external', $obj);
104
106
            }
105
107
        }
 
108
        $badgescache->delete($USER->id);
106
109
        redirect(new moodle_url('/badges/mybadges.php'));
107
110
    }
108
111
} else {